Gravesend to Outwood by train

A train trip from Gravesend to Outwood takes about 4hrs 13 mins on average, covering roughly 175 miles (283 kilometres). With around 32 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£45.10,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Gravesend to Outwood start from as little as £45.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Gravesend to Outwood start from £78.00 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Gravesend to Outwood are available for £171.60 one way

Facilities and Amenities

Gravesend station offers a wide range of amenities to make your journey as smooth as possible. The ticket office is open from 05:45 to 20:00 on weekdays and Saturdays, with slightly later hours on Sundays, letting you buy or collect tickets at your convenience. For tech-savvy travelers, smartcard options are available, and tickets purchased online can be collected via the accessible ticket machines onsite.

For those requiring assistance, step-free access ensures mobility throughout the station, and accessible toilets are available on Platforms 0 and 2 during staffing hours. If you need a quick energy boost or some light reading for your journey, a coffee shop and a selection of newspapers are available at Platform 0. While the station is well equipped, it lacks some comforts, such as waiting rooms or an ATM machine. However, the friendly staff is always on hand to provide assistance where needed.

Travel Connections and Onward Journey Options

With easy access to a variety of transportation links, continuing your journey from Gravesend station is effortless. Should you find yourself in need of a taxi, the side of the station on Roathmoor Road is where you'll find them waiting. Additionally, local bus services can be found on Clive Road, with convenient ways to plan your journey available here.

Facilities and Amenities at Outwood Station

At Outwood Station, a variety of facilities are at your disposal to ensure a smooth travel experience. While there is no ticket office, travelers can conveniently purchase and collect tickets at the many available ticket machines. For those who require accessibility support, induction loops and accessible ticket machines are available to ease your journey. Step-free access is available in parts of the station, making it a Category B station. While there are no waiting rooms or seating areas, the station provides CCTV for added security.

For those concerned with security and assistance, although there is no staff help available on-site, assistance can be provided by conductors upon train arrival. If further help is needed, travelers can utilize the customer help points stationed around the platform or use the helpline service. Despite its smaller scale, Outwood Station is tailored to accommodate your travel needs effectively.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Whatever your travel plans, you'll find excellent onward travel options at Outwood. For those needing a taxi service, bookings can be made through the Cab4You service, connecting you seamlessly to your next destination. Bus services are readily accessible, with stops located conveniently on Lingwell Gate Lane, a short walk from the station. Travelers preferring to explore on two wheels will find bicycle facilities available within the station's car park.
